Google recently announced improvements to Google+ Hangouts and photos. The changes are designed to take some of the work out of messaging, video calling and photo editing. For the first time Google+ Hangouts, which I use quite a lot, support both location sharing and SMS. Google Hangouts 2.0 Related articles.

You can hide your hashtags from view by simply tapping on the list and pinching it with your fingers until it’s vanished from sight: You can use this tip with other tagging elements, like mentions and location tags, to keep your Instagram Stories fresh and uncluttered.
